Details on results:
The maximum difference of the concentrations determined in the 24, 48 and 72 hour test samples was ≤ 15%. Based on this, the water solubility of the test item is given as the mean value of the analyzed concentrations.
No test item was detected in the pretreated sample from the blank water mixture.

Applicant's summary and conclusion

Conclusions:
The flask method was applied for the determination of the water solubility of JNJ-39125190-AAA (T003897).
The water solubility of the test item at 20°C was 0.382 g/L.
The pH of the aqueous samples was 6.9 and 7.0.
